How to Replace Your Key Fob

When you find yourself in requirement of a key fob replacement, there are numerous approaches you can take. Below are some popular alternatives:

1. Dealer Replacement:

  • Pros: Assurance of O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) quality; usually consists of programming support.
  • Cons: Can be rather pricey and take longer than other choices.

2. Automotive Locksmith:

  • Pros: Generally more cost effective than dealerships; can supply mobile service straight at your area.
  • Cons: Not all locksmith professionals are geared up to program advanced key fob systems.

3. Online Retailers:

  • Pros: Cost-effective options can often be found; numerous sellers supply programming instructions.
  • Cons: Requires some DIY skill and might not always guarantee compatibility with your vehicle.

4. Aftermarket Options:

  • Pros: Cheaper options readily available; frequently programmable without dealer intervention.
  • Cons: Quality can differ; might lack some specialized features of OEM fobs.

Approximated Costs of Key Fob Replacement

The cost of changing a key fob can vary widely based on several aspects.

Replacement MethodApproximate Cost RangeAdditional Fees
Dealership₤ 150 - ₤ 600Shows fees might use
Automotive Locksmith₤ 50 - ₤ 300Programs costs might use
Online Purchase₤ 15 - ₤ 100Delivering expenses might use
Aftermarket Options₤ 20 - ₤ 150Programs costs might apply

Essential: Always confirm if the price consists of programs and other required services.
